Conditions

The extracerebral tumor origing from the skull base

Interventions

A:Normal surgical procedure to rebuild the skull bas
B:Normal procedure following by the arachnoial separation and the reconstruction of the dural sac with artificial dura material
C:Normal procedure following by the arachnoial separation and the reconstruction of the dural sac with the periosteum and artificial dura combined material

Inclusion criteria

Inclusion criteria: 1. The extracerebral tumor origing from the skull base (meningiomas, chordoma, pituitary adenomas, acoustic neuroma, trigeminal nerve schwannoma, sellar craniopharyngiomas, bone neoplasms, et al); 2. The primary treated by transcranial surgery; 3. Without undergoing postoperative radiotherapy; 4. Tumor recurrence occuring during the research period; 5. The secondary transcranial operation used to treat the reccurence tumor; 6. Sufficient clinical recording, experimental detection, pre- and postoperative MR and CT images; 7. The subjects or their guardian signed a study consent form before enrollment.

Exclusion criteria

Exclusion criteria: 1. Intracerebral tumor; 2. The primary palliative treatment or treated by transsphenoidal approach; 3. Undergoing the postsurgical common or focus radiotherapy; 4. Loss follow-up or without the sufficient clinical database.
